What is the best strategy for writing Amherst College supplement essays?

I’m starting to work on Amherst’s supplement and want to make sure I approach it the right way. Since the school seems to care a lot about thoughtful, specific writing, I’m trying to figure out how to make my answers feel genuine instead of generic.

I’m especially wondering what kind of themes or details tend to work best for Amherst supplemental essays.

The best strategy for Amherst supplement essays is to sound intellectually alive, specific, and self-aware. Amherst values open curriculum freedom, close faculty-student engagement, and a campus culture that takes ideas seriously, so your essays should show how you think, not just what you have done. The strongest responses usually focus on one or two sharp, revealing details rather than trying to summarize your whole personality.

For Amherst, generic praise like “I love small classes” or “I want academic freedom” is not enough. If you mention the open curriculum, connect it to the way you actually learn: maybe you like building unexpected links between fields, pursuing questions before you know where they lead, or designing your own academic path without a core checklist. Amherst wants to see that freedom matters to you for a real reason, not just because it sounds appealing.

Themes that tend to work well are intellectual curiosity, nuanced self-reflection, and meaningful engagement with ideas or communities. A strong topic might be a niche question you keep returning to, a moment when your thinking changed, or a small experience that reveals how you observe people, texts, systems, or problems.

Be concrete about Amherst itself, but stay selective. It is better to mention one course, professor, program, tradition, or student organization and explain why it fits you than to list five resources.

What usually falls flat is broad community-service language, resume-style achievement summaries, or overly polished essays that do not reveal an actual mind at work. Amherst’s supplement is a place to be precise, thoughtful, and a little vulnerable in an intellectual sense.
